Regional Analysis
North America
Lead: USAThe dominant market region with high dental care expenditure and advanced healthcare infrastructure driving consistent demand for premium products.
Europe
Lead: GermanyStable growth driven by established dental care systems and increasing focus on infection control protocols.
Asia Pacific
Lead: ChinaFastest-growing region due to expanding middle-class populations, rising dental awareness, and healthcare infrastructure development.

Competitive Landscape
Medline Industries
USA
Global leader in medical supplies with extensive dental gauze portfolio and strong distribution network
Cardinal Health
USA
Major distributor with broad dental product offerings and significant presence in North America and Europe
Henry Schein
USA
Leading dental supply chain partner with strong focus on practice management solutions
3M
USA
Innovative materials science company with antimicrobial dental gauze solutions
Dentsply Sirona
Germany
Dental technology leader with integrated gauze products for clinical workflows
